Historic Heat Records Shattered Across United Kingdom
The United Kingdom witnessed an extraordinary meteorological event when the hottest June day on record was officially documented, with temperatures climbing to an unprecedented 36.1°C recorded in Hampshire on Wednesday afternoon. This remarkable achievement marks a significant milestone in British weather history, surpassing all previously established records for the month of June.
